Sneak extra goodness into mealtimes
This tasty hidden veg pasta sauce is perfect for fussy eaters. It's ideal for little ones and great for batch freezing. Cook once, freeze for later!
- 1 tbsp oil
- 1 medium onion, finely chopped
- 2 garlic cloves, crushed
- 3 carrots, finely chopped
- 2 celery sticks, finely chopped
- 2 courgettes, finely chopped
- 1 red pepper, chopped
- 700g of passata
- 500ml of veg stock
- 1tsp dried Italian herbs
- 1tsp paprika
- Heat the oil in a large saucepan. Add the onions and fry for 2-3 minutes. Add the garlic and fry for another minute before adding the carrots, celery, courgette and red pepper.
- Pour in the veg stock and passata and stir well. Add the tomato puree, dried herbs and paprika and bring to the boil.
- Simmer on a medium heat for about 20 minutes or until the vegetables are soft.
- Remove from the heat and blitz either with a hand blender or in an upright blender until smooth.
- Pour the sauce into jars, containers or freezer bags and allow to cool before refrigerating or freezing.
